B&B, HORSE RIDE SPECIAL: Includes a bedroom with private bath in our rustic lodge, cowboy breakfast and an awesome 2 hour guided horseback ride in mountain splendor.
3-5 DAY PACKAGES ALL-INCLUSIVE: Activities, rooms, meals, and UNLIMITED RIDING. Chuck wagon cookouts, campfires, hayrides, trout fishing, climb, hike or mountain bike. Whitewater rafting is not far away.
The ranch is a family owned 3,000 acre working cattle outfit. This is our 100th anniversary! Looking for a real Western Adventure you'll never forget?
Live a cowboy's dream.
Our ranch guests say this is the best cross-country riding and majestic scenery they have ever experienced. Beginner and advanced riders are welcome. Improve your skills, free instruction. View elk, moose, deer, antelope, and other wildlife from horseback.
Imagine yourself riding on a real roundup and cattle drive. Your friends back home won't believe it so bring your camera!
Great family style meals await you in our 1890 ranch house. Enjoy a crackling fire in our fireplace lounge.
Got an RV? You are welcome here with full hookups and a beautiful view of mountains and meadow. Tent camping not available.
Located 2 hours north of Denver on Highway 287 near Virginia Dale. Our spread straddles the Colorado-Wyoming border. Picture yourself in both states on the same horseback ride.
We're different. We're a real ranch, not a commercial resort.
